About EchoLink
EchoLink connects amateur radio repeaters and simplex stations over the internet. You can connect using RF through a local EchoLink node or directly via computer software.
โข Node Numbers: 4-6 digit numbers that identify each station
โข *ECHOTEST*: Node 9999 - Test your audio and connection
โข Conference Servers: Multi-user chat rooms (usually 3-digit numbers)
โข RF Nodes: Connect via radio to access the EchoLink network

๐ป How to Use EchoLink
Via RF (Radio)
- 1. Find a local EchoLink-enabled repeater
- 2. Access the repeater normally
- 3. Send DTMF tones to connect to nodes
- 4. Use # to disconnect, * for commands
Via Computer
- 1. Download EchoLink software
- 2. Validate your license with EchoLink
- 3. Connect to nodes directly via internet
- 4. Use headset/microphone for audio
